Quality Assurance (QA) Coordinator
We currently seek a high caliber Quality Assurance Coordinator for a long-term basis within our client’s team of experienced professionals. Based in Los Angeles County, CA

Summary of position:
The Quality Assurance Coordinator is responsible for performing all administrative aspects for the Quality Assurance Department and Quality Management System. The position performs a vital part in enhancing the Company’s infrastructure, and has the capability to contribute to the strength and sustainable growth of the company.
Requirements / Must haves:
• High School Diploma. College courses/Seminars/Training a plus
• Knowledge and/or experience in an industry regulated by Quality System Regulations
• Understanding of FDA Quality System and ISO regulations
• Experience in ophthalmic industry desirable

Job Duties:
• Coordinate activities for and maintain the Quality Management System
• Provide documentation support for domestic and international product introduction and/or registrations as required
• Document Nonconformance Reports (NCR)
• Document Corrective and Preventive Actions (CAPA)
• Maintain files and logs of Material Review Board (MRB) activities
• Provide administrative support, create documents, correspondence, memos, etc., pertinent to Quality Assurance issues
• Assist during internal and external Quality Audits as needed
• Assist in New Supplier Evaluation activities
• Update product Technical Files as it pertains to Controlled Documentation Changes
• Train new personnel; assist in training of production personnel, if required
• Maintain Quality Records
• Maintain confidentiality of Company business information and documents
